Justin Bieber publishes ‘Swag II’ with Tems, Bakar and Hurricane Chris

Introduction to Justin Bieber’s New Album

Justin Bieber has released "Swag II", a follow-up to his surprise album, which was announced less than 24 hours prior to its release. This new album comes after his previous surprise album, which was released in July with similarly little warning.

Album Details

The new record, "Swag II", contains 23 songs and features guest appearances from notable artists such as Tems, Lil B, Bakar, Hurricane Chris, and Eddie Benjamin. The album was initially released on YouTube Music after midnight, before becoming available on other streaming services.

Release Delay and Announcement

Justin Bieber took to Instagram to address the delay in the album’s release, stating "I’m sorry that they told me for a second." He had previously announced the upcoming arrival of the album on Instagram, confirming that it would be released at midnight. Bieber also promoted the album by posting photos from the studio in the months leading up to its release, hinting that he was working on new music.

Background and Previous Work

Bieber’s previous album, "Swag", was released with 21 tracks and featured guest appearances by Gunna, Sexyy Red, Druki, Dijon, Lil B, Cash Cobain, Eddie Benjamin, and Marvin Winans. Bieber worked on the production of "Swag" alongside contributors such as Tobias Jesso Jr., Carter Lang, Dylan Wiggins, Daniel Caesar, Mk.Gee, Daniel Chetrit, Knox Fortune, and more.

Chart Performance

The initial "Swag" album debuted at number two on the Billboard 200 and marked Bieber’s largest streaming week to date. The album’s singles, "Gänseblümchen", "Yukon", and "First Place", also performed well on the Billboard Hot 100, reaching second, eighth, and 52nd place respectively.

Listening to "Swag II"

"Swag II" is now available to stream, and fans can listen to the new album below. With its release, "Swag II" adds to the total number of tracks from the "Swag" series, bringing the total to 44 songs.
